Definition of coulomb noun from the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ary

coulomb

noun
 
/ˈkuːlɒm/
 
/ˈkuːlɑːm/,
 
/ˈkuːləʊm/
(abbreviation C)
(physics)
jump to other results
  1. a unit for measuring electric charge
    Word Originlate 19th cent.: named after Charles-Augustin de Coulomb (1736–1806), French military engineer.
